Hello,

my name is Ashley Bastock:

I am currently a Cleveland Browns beat reporter for cleveland.com, covering my hometown NFL team. I am always on the lookout for interesting feature and enterprise angles.

Prior to this role, I worked for the Akron Beacon Journal, covering primarily high school sports with college and the pro coverage mixed in.

In my first newspaper job, I covered the University of Michigan beat for The Toledo Blade focusing on football and men's basketball. I began working at The Blade in September of 2018 as a general assignment sports reporter and transitioned to the Michigan beat June 2019.

In 2016, I left my job as a production assistant at NBC News' Meet the Press to pursue a career in sports journalism. I began working freelance and covered the Cleveland Cavaliers, Indians, Browns and high school sports for the Associated Press, Fear The Sword, NEO Sports Insiders and Metro Networks.

As my experience up until this point shows, I am willing to work to succeed in this incredibly competitive field. When I made the decision to leave my job with MTP, I knew I was taking a big, but hopefully rewarding, risk. So far, I have not been disappointed, and am confident that this is the right field for me as I continue to improve my work.
